Emerging technologies are enhancing Cambodia’s solar industry: Bifacial Solar Panels: Generate electricity from both sides, increasing efficiency. Perovskite Solar Cells: Offer higher energy conversion rates than traditional panels. Battery Storage Systems: Improve energy reliability by storing excess power for later use.
Self-unloading mobile Solar Container. Our Solar Containers are designed in a way to maximize ease of operation. It’s not only meant to transport PVs but also to unfold them on site. It is based on a 20’ sea container. The efficient hydraulic system helps quickly prepare the Solar to work.
